OZMO MEGA MOPPING SYSTEM – All-zone vibrating mop over 480 times/minute, deeply dissolving stubborn stains on the ground. The extra-large composite material mop cloth is equipped with a 180ml electrically-controlled water replenishment system, ensuring that the ground is always as clean as new. The 6N power continuous pressure fits tightly to the ground, reducing pressure for you.
8000PA POWERFUL SUCTION – YEEDI C12 PRO PLUS is driven by a new high-speed motor and adopts a straight-through vacuum dust design to reduce suction loss. It strengthens the suction power for carpet environments and easily removes large debris.
PURECYCLONE TECHNOLOGY – YEEDI C12 PRO PLUS uses the latest PureCyclone Technology that automatically collects dust in just 10s. With its 4-layer filter system and 14 small cyclones, it continuously separates fine dust up to 2mm and prevents secondary pollution. Additionally, the dustbin is reusable and eliminates the need for disposable bags, making it an environmentally-friendly and energy-saving choice.
ZEROTANGLE ANTI-TANGLE TECHNOLOGY – YEEDI C12 PRO PLUS prevents hair entanglement and ensures efficient suction by incorporating Dual Comb Teeth Arrays for flow-guide and a newly designed anti-tangling roller brush employs a structure with 21° flat bristles and outward-rotating angled bristles, providing users with a hassle-free cleaning experience and minimal maintenance, with a tangling rate as low as 0%.
TRUEMAPPING TECH – 8-minute fast mapping, close-range scanning accuracy can reach within 10mm, accurately positioning the room. TrueMapping intelligent path planning can perform 360-degree laser ranging scans within the range of the ranging radius, using the bow-shaped walking cleaning plan to comprehensively clean without any omissions.
MULTI-SENSOR FUSION – 20mm easy obstacle crossing function, combined with 4 down-view anti-drop sensors, provides the machine with a self-safe escort. The super-intelligent carpet recognition function ensures that no stains are left on your carpet. Equipped with a 5200mAh battery, a single charge can support 300 minutes of endurance.
EXCLUSIVE APP OPERATING SYSTEM – Multiple modes available — 4-level suction, water volume, dual cleaning modes, etc., which can adapt to different home environments. Customized exclusive cleaning mode, customizable map editing, customize your cleaning experience.

12/29/2024 Update: After some time with this robot, it is still working great. The app prompts when it’s time to clean (wipe sensors, clean filter or replace parts). I just did the first cleaning of the bin and filter area (still 10 hours left on the original filter). I have a replacement part bundle waiting for when it’s time to actually replace something. No issues other than the app messing up the map (twice so far) which is easily restored from a backup (the fact that they have backup as an option tells me this must be something they expect to happen). It also was having LDS (the spinning sensor part, I think) errors, solved by cleaning around that part. I am still blown away by how much stuff this picks up compared to every model Roomba I have had.
I bought the very first Roomba model when it came out, and have been using various models of Roombas ever since. I have three currently, with the newest one being a self-emptying S9+.
This Yeedi is so much better, so let me get the only negatives out of the way first:
1. The C12 Pro Plus is listed as being able to climb over a .7″ bump. My threshold between hallway to kitchen is more than that, and the C12 gets stuck there. Sometimes it will make it over, but it won’t go back (probably a cliff sensor reacting to the black rubber transition strip we hav there). Workaround: A mall mat. After that, no issue. 2. The C12 has multiple levels of vacuuming power. On the highest level (a tornado icon), it pulls up the light throw rugs from the kitchen floor and gets stuck on them. It has no issues with any of the heavier throw rugs. Workaround: Yeedi lets you adjust the suction power by zone, so I just dropped down the power when doing the kitchen. After that, no issue. (Roomba has no issue with this, probably due to its much weaker suction.)
Everything else is far superior to any of the iRobot devices I have had — even one that cost twice as much as this Yeedi!
Epic features:
1. The station uses a bagless bin that the robot empties in to. Not only does this save money (no bags to by) but you can easily see when it needs to be emptied. It gets handfuls of pet hair and fluff every time, even after the Roomba has been ran.
2. The mapping is so fast. It just drives around while the little spinning sensor on the top (Lidar? maybe?) figures out where the walls are. The map it produced was much more accurate! It also figures out where rugs are and represents them on the map after a job.
3. The app shows the route the Yeedi took! If you set it for 1-pass, you see a smart zig-zag pattern. When you set it for 2-pass, you will see it does a criss-cross pattern. While vacuuming, the app shows where the robot is in realtime. Fascinating to watch!
4. The robot has a pop-off side brush for easy cleaning. No need for a screwdriver! And, I have yet to find a bundle of hair under it, like the Roomba seems to do after every few cycles.
5. The brushes have some kind of magic. The Roomba needs regular cleaning where you remove the brushes and pull balls of hair from each end, and cut strands that have wrapped around the brush. After 30+ hours of using the Yeedi (in a two pet household), not once have I had to do that. HOW is this possible?
6. The app lets you send it to just a specific room, or tap multiple rooms just to do them. Current higher end Roombas have this feature, but the Yeedi app makes it much easier to actually use.
…and so much more. The unit backs in to the dock, announcing that it is charging, then emptying the bin, then will resume after that. It navigates very well, around objects, slowing down before hitting things. Whatever they are doing, it is very advanced and not at all what I had expected from a brand I have never heard of.
And it mops. I have an iRobot Baava robot mop that has an advantage of being much smaller (it will fit between the toilet and the wall). The Yeedi has a mopping bin (remote the dust bin, fill the mop bin with water and plug it in). It does not use special pads (it comes with two Velcro-on reusable pads). It does not do any soap — just water — so the Braava might be doing a better job. BUT, after letting it run one time, the pad came back dirtier than I’ve ever seen the Braava’s. The mop also vibrates as it goes, much more intensely than the tiny Braava.
GREAT SUPPORT: I have written their support a few times, asking about issues with the threshold (they suggested the mat) and the carpets (lower the suction). They have been very helpful with suggestions, and respond within day.
I went in to this highly skeptical that it could be any good. At half the price of a high end Roomba, I expected half the quality. After 30+ hours in use (then the app teaches you where to wipe down with a cloth to clean sensors!) I am not 100% convinced this is the best vacuum robot I have ever had. (I do not have enough experience with robot mops — but have owned the Scooba and Braava.)
I think that’s all I have to say. I am blown away by how good this unit works. If they could make it handle larger thresholds, that would remove my only real nitpick.
Kudos to Yeedi.
